A tiny platformer. My first full game. Made in Godot and Aseprite*

* in the graphics department, I made the player sprite from scratch, but most of the assets are from Kenney (kenney.nl)

Note: due to an issue with Godot web exports, the web version on itch.io (linked below) may take a while to load on macOS. The downloadable executables should run without issue
